One thing I've always wondered about Shield's place in the MCU (before winter soldier) is if they were the intelligence apparatus, what does the USA have the CIA for? Would that not be redundant?
Plus shield evolved from the SSR, so it should predate any need to have established the CIA post war.
The only thing I can think of is that SHIELD was a semi-global intelligence force (e.g. shared by NATO allies). Would explain why there was a world council that Fury reported too.

SHIELD was created in the sixties during the spy boom of the sixties. It was Marvel's version of U.N.C.L.E. vs THRUSH, CONTROL vs KAOS, ergo SHIELD vs HYDRA.
